Understanding Mobile Mixing Plants
A mobile mixing plant is a sophisticated apparatus designed to produce concrete and other materials on the job site itself. Unlike traditional mixing plants, which are usually fixed and require significant investment in infrastructure and transportation, mobile mixing plants are compact, transportable, and relatively easy to set up. This flexibility allows companies to quickly respond to changing site conditions and project demands.
Key Components of Mobile Mixing Plants
Mobile mixing plants are comprised of several essential components that contribute to their functionality:
- Aggregate Bins: These hold the raw materials like sand, gravel, or crushed stone until they are mixed.
- Cement Silos: Storage for different types of cement, allowing for blending various compositions.
- Mixing Unit: The heart of the plant, where ingredients are combined according to specified proportions.
- Control System: Advanced digital controls that regulate the mixing process, including ingredient ratios and timing.
- Transport System: A concrete pump or conveyor system to transfer the mixed product to the area of use, enhancing the efficiency of material delivery.
Benefits of Using Mobile Mixing Plants
The adoption of mobile mixing plants comes with multiple advantages that can significantly benefit businesses in various sectors:
1. Increased Flexibility and Mobility
The primary advantage of a mobile mixing plant is its ability to move directly to the job site. This mobility minimizes the need for transporting mixed materials over long distances, thereby reducing logistical costs and time delays.
2. Cost-Effectiveness
By producing concrete on-site, businesses can save on transportation costs and reduce waste. Additionally, the modularity of mobile mixing plants often means lower initial capital investment compared to traditional fixed plants.
3. Reduced Material Wastage
Mobile mixing plants can be adjusted to produce the exact amount of material needed at any given time. This precision not only saves money but also contributes to environmental sustainability by minimizing waste.
4. Enhanced Quality Control
With the mixing occurring onsite, quality can be better monitored and controlled. Operators can make instant adjustments to ensure consistency and meet project specifications without waiting for deliveries from a central plant.
5. Sustainability Benefits
Using mobile mixing plants can have positive environmental impacts. They often use fewer resources and can utilize local materials, which supports sustainability. Additionally, the ability to produce concrete as needed reduces the carbon footprint associated with transporting materials.

Technological Innovations in Mobile Mixing Plants
The landscape of mobile mixing plants is continuously evolving, influenced by technological advances that enhance their operation:
1. Automation and Control Systems
Modern mobile mixing plants are equipped with sophisticated automation technology, allowing for precise control over the mixing process. Integrated software solutions enable real-time adjustments to ingredients and proportions, ensuring optimal quality.
2. Telematics
Telematics technology provides critical data and analytics about plant performance. This includes monitoring for maintenance needs, operational efficiency, and productivity analytics, contributing to better decision-making.
3. Eco-Friendly Innovations
As the industry evolves, eco-friendly practices are being integrated into mobile mixing plants. New designs focus on reducing energy consumption, recycling materials, and lowering emissions, aligning with global sustainability goals.
4. Advanced Mixing Techniques
Innovations like high-efficiency mixers and improved blending techniques lead to better quality mixes faster. These advancements reduce energy consumption and increase output rates, which is vital for busy job sites.
Choosing the Right Mobile Mixing Plant
Selecting the appropriate mobile mixing plant for your needs requires careful consideration of several factors:
- Production Capacity: Determine how much concrete you will need to produce and at what frequency. This will influence the size and specifications of the mobile mixer.
- Storage Requirements: Consider your space for raw materials and finished products. This includes the size of aggregate bins and cement silos.
- Control Technology: Evaluate how much automation and control you need for consistency and efficiency.

- Maintenance and Support: Ensure there is adequate local support for maintenance and spare parts. This helps minimize downtime.
